## v2.9.0 — Changed defaults

Fixed the memory leak in the Pickerel image cache caused by unbounded thumbnail retention. Eviction is now mandatory; the old unlimited mode is removed. If heap alerts fire after upgrade, do not roll back — restart with the new defaults instead. The cache now ships with these configuration values:

service settings:
[silwyn]
host = silwyn.crelvogrid.internal
user = silwyn_svc
database = silwyn_prod

FINANCE REVIEW SUMMARY — Q3 Cash-Flow Forecast

Hey sales leads — quick rundown. Inflows tracking about six percent ahead of plan, mostly thanks to the Ardelane renewals landing early. Outflows are lumpy: the Fennridge tooling payment hits in week eight, so expect a dip before recovery. Receivables aging improved; keep pushing the slow payers. Overall, we're comfortable but not cushy. The strategic reasoning sits in the note below.

confidential, yawif-fadup: The southern region missed its Eliius quota by 61.1 percent last quarter. Istixax Freight plans to raise the Jorwyn list price by 65.7 percent in October. The board signed off on a budget of $445.3 million for Project Ulaox. The renewal with Briathax Partners closes at $41.0 million a year, 49.9 percent below the last contract.

## Deploying the Gatewick Proctor Queue

Deploys are pretty painless: push to main, wait for the pipeline, then watch the queue drain dashboard for five minutes. If candidates pile up mid-exam, roll back first and ask questions later — the queue replays safely. Everything the workers care about lives in one config block, shown here for reference.

settings of bafof-yagef:
JOROX_PIN=8740
JOROX_TENANT=pelox
JOROX_METRICS_HOST=metrics.jorox.qorvelworks.internal
JOROX_SEAL=seal_c78f63c1
JOROX_STANDBY_TEAM=norax